rest - 免费 Rest API 以字符串形式检索当前日期时间(与时区无关)

标签 rest api time timer timezone-offset

我正在寻找一个可靠的REST API,它可以提供跨平台的世界时间和时区信息

我需要当前时间作为字符串。我希望它能够在一秒内返回结果,无论用户位于世界各地。

在其他实现中,我想将其用于一致的倒计时器,比用户的[可能不准确的]计算机时间更准确。可以是GMT,也可以是其他时区,只要指定时区和偏移量即可,如2012-11-05 16:16:50 EST .

我会自己构建这个 API,但在通过像 Rails 这样的整个大型软件堆栈过滤某人只是为了返回一个简单的 String 时,我会担心潜在的延迟问题(以及不雅)。 。

对于远离美国东海岸的用户来说,过多的延迟会抵消任务所需的准确性带来的好处。

任何建议和/或示例表示赞赏。

最佳答案

TimezoneDb提供免费的API:http://timezonedb.com/api

GenoNames 还具有 RESTful API,可用于获取给定位置的当前时间:http://www.geonames.org/export/ws-overview.html

如果您需要 GMT,可以使用英国格林威治。

关于rest - 免费 Rest API 以字符串形式检索当前日期时间(与时区无关),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13240530/

相关文章:

java - 使用 JWT 的基于角色的 Rest-API

javascript - 直接在 URL 中过滤 API 响应

c# - 具有 128 位键的基于时间的字典/哈希表,即超时字典中的值

r - 如何计算每月的时差?

java - 处理 Mule 流中的特定异常

c# - ASP.net Web API 中 MVC 的 DefaultModelBinder 的等价物是什么?

javascript - FreshBooks API 库

api - HTTPS 请求仅在 iOS、Ionic 2 上失败

c++ - struct 和 time_t 的计算错误

c# - Windows注销后如何继续运行C#应用程序